Traditional Banks Have Tightened Lending Criteria

Canadian banks have implemented increasingly strict lending guidelines following regulatory changes and economic uncertainty. The federal stress test requires borrowers to qualify at rates significantly higher than actual mortgage rates, making it difficult for many Toronto homeowners to access additional financing through conventional channels. 

Even homeowners with substantial equity and good payment histories often find themselves declined by traditional lenders due to debt service ratio calculations or employment type. Second mortgage lenders operate outside these rigid frameworks, assessing applications based on property value and equity rather than exclusively on income multiples and credit formulas.

Flexible Approval for Self-Employed and Non-Traditional Income

Toronto’s diverse economy includes countless self-employed professionals, contractors, and entrepreneurs who struggle to meet traditional lending requirements. Banks typically require two years of tax returns showing consistent income, which doesn’t reflect the reality of many successful self-employed individuals. 

Second mortgage lenders focus primarily on equity and property value rather than employment documentation. Freelancers, commission-based workers, and business owners can access their home equity without the extensive income verification that banks demand. 

This flexibility has made second mortgages essential for Toronto’s entrepreneurial community and gig economy workers.

Debt Consolidation at Lower Overall Interest Costs

Credit card debt, personal loans, and other high-interest obligations can trap Toronto homeowners in expensive debt cycles. Second mortgages allow consolidation of these debts into a single payment at significantly lower interest rates:

  • Credit cards charging 19-29% can be replaced with second mortgage rates of 8-15%
  • Multiple payment dates simplified into one monthly obligation
  • Improved cash flow through lower total monthly payments
  • Potential credit score improvement as revolving debt decreases
  • Clear path to becoming debt-free with fixed repayment terms

For homeowners carrying substantial high-interest debt, the savings from consolidation through a second mortgage can amount to thousands of dollars annually while simplifying their financial management.

Credit Challenges Don’t Automatically Disqualify Applicants

Life events like divorce, medical emergencies, or business setbacks can damage credit scores, making traditional mortgage approval nearly impossible. Second mortgage lenders in Toronto recognize that credit scores don’t tell the complete story of a person’s financial situation. 

Late payments, collections, consumer proposals, or even previous bankruptcy don’t automatically result in denial. Lenders evaluate the overall picture, including current equity, property condition, and ability to make payments. 

This approach gives Toronto homeowners with credit challenges a pathway to access their home equity and potentially rebuild their financial standing.
